The healthcare market doesn’t work like every other free market. Hospitals raise their prices at will, without much consideration of their competition. Although those prices don’t generally matter because payments are based on the type of insurance coverage a patient has, they do matter when very sick patients exceed insurance thresholds. ACAP Health CEO, Wally Gomaa shared, “This is the No. 1 cause of hospital price inflation today”. Click to view Jim Lander’s article in the Dallas Morning News.
